Output 249d8f6ad3f0bf9588d71002a1e0511e78fe0cddf171b30205634ecfb6a831bd:0

value
388854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af63cc3ad60d20f5bf121c81f40ed7b4cf7215da OP_EQUAL
address
3HgPjBgEEEzJ4wf2HJQNASVZczu5Bu9WKu
transaction
249d8f6ad3f0bf9588d71002a1e0511e78fe0cddf171b30205634ecfb6a831bd
spent
true